Halal Assurance System (HAS)
The Halal Assurance System (HAS) is a structured management system designed to ensure that products remain compliant with halal requirements throughout the entire production process.
This system controls ingredients, production procedures, documentation, traceability, storage and internal monitoring to maintain the halal integrity of certified products.
Main objectives of the Halal Assurance System
- Ensure that all materials used in production are halal compliant.
- Maintain traceability of ingredients and products.
- Prevent cross-contamination with non-halal materials.
- Maintain proper documentation and monitoring procedures.
- Ensure continuous internal auditing and compliance.
Halal Assurance System Implementation
HAS implementation audit covers the following aspects:- Halal Management Organization
- Completeness of Halal Assurance System documents
- Completeness of material specifications
- Completeness and validity of material halal certification
- Conformity between product formulas and halal material lists
- Conformity between purchasing documents and halal material lists
- Completeness and conformity between production documents and halal material lists
- Completeness and conformity between warehousing documents and halal materials
- Traceability of the halal assurance system

Monitoring and evaluation of HAS implementation. Internal and external reporting of HAS implementation.Internal Audit Activity
1. Schedule
Internal Halal Audit is conducted at least every six months or whenever changes occur that may affect the halal status of a product. These changes may include management changes, policy changes, formulation updates, material changes, or production process modifications.2. Method
Internal Halal Audit can be conducted using the following methods:- Interview and cross-checking
- Document verification and validation
